Transaction 9040ae5fc7c098da13355500b2525214129f00803a76599d1e0134e8a27caf92
1 Input
1 Output
-
9040ae5fc7c098da13355500b2525214129f00803a76599d1e0134e8a27caf92:0
- value
- 1086716
- script pubkey
- OP_0 OP_PUSHBYTES_20 fb501073fc072bd3ceca4d17f0b38027d6cd5044
- address
- bc1qldgpquluqu4a8nk2f5tlpvuqyltv65zyemv6qh